Engraver for Blender
Engraver for Blender – The Ultimate Procedural Surface Etching & Inscription Tool
Download Engraver for Blender on Windows and Mac, a specialized Geometry Nodes-based addon designed to instantly carve text, logos, patterns, and intricate designs directly onto any 3D surface with realistic depth and displacement. Whether you need to add serial numbers to hard-surface models, inscribe runes on fantasy weapons, or etch labels onto product packaging, Engraver transforms how artists apply surface details, eliminating the need for manual boolean operations, complex sculpting, or high-resolution texture baking for simple markings.
Key Features of Engraver:
- Instant Surface Carving: Projects vector paths, text objects, or image contours onto any mesh (flat, curved, or organic) and automatically displaces the geometry inward or outward to create true 3D engravings.
- Smart Curvature Adaptation: Unlike standard decals, Engraver respects the underlying topology, ensuring engraved lines follow the surface normals perfectly without stretching or floating, even on complex spheres or characters.
- Variable Depth Control: Use grayscale maps or vertex groups to control engraving depth dynamically, allowing for tapered edges, worn-out effects, or variable stroke thickness within a single operation.
- Bevel & Chamfer Automation: Automatically adds micro-bevels to the carved edges to catch light realistically, preventing the “sharp CGI” look and simulating the natural wear of cutting tools or lasers.
- Multi-Layer Support: Stack multiple engraving layers to create complex bas-reliefs, overlapping text, or nested patterns without destructive boolean conflicts.
- Procedural Pattern Library: Includes over 50+ built-in procedural patterns (hatching, cross-hatch, stippling, gears, circuitry) that can be scaled and rotated instantly without external images.
- Text & SVG Integration: Directly links to Blender’s Text objects and imported SVG curves, updating the engraving in real-time as you edit the source text or path.
- Material Slot Assignment: Automatically assigns a distinct material slot to the engraved faces (e.g., darkened metal inside a cut, or glowing ink), streamlining the shading workflow.
- Non-Destructive Workflow: Entirely procedural; change the text, swap the pattern, adjust the depth, or modify the target mesh at any time before final conversion to static geometry.
Perfect For:
- Hard-Surface Modelers adding panel lines, warning labels, serial numbers, and manufacturer logos to vehicles and robots.
- Fantasy Artists inscribing magical runes, ancient scripts, and decorative filigree on weapons, armor, and artifacts.
- Product Designers prototyping branded packaging, embossed buttons, and serialized industrial parts.
- Jewelry Designers creating intricate monograms and detailed relief work on rings and pendants.
- Anyone who needs crisp, geometric surface details that look better than normal maps but are faster than sculpting.
System Requirements:
- Blender: 3.6, 4.0, 4.1, 4.2, 4.3+ (Geometry Nodes required).
- OS: Windows 10/11 (64-bit) or macOS 10.15+.
- RAM: 8GB minimum (16GB+ recommended for high-density pattern carving).
- No external dependencies required.
Installation:
- Download the Engraver
.zipfile or.blendasset. - If an addon: Go to Edit > Preferences > Add-ons, click Install, select the file, and enable Geometry Nodes: Engraver.
- If a node group: Open the file, append the “Engraver” node group, and connect it to your target mesh in the Geometry Nodes editor.
- Access via the Modifier Properties panel or the Object Context Menu > Add Engraving.
Note:
The addon features a unique “Wear & Tear” module that automatically introduces random noise and edge chipping to the engraved lines, simulating age, corrosion, or imperfect manufacturing processes. It also includes a “Laser Burn” preset that darkens the surrounding area of the cut to simulate heat discoloration, adding immediate realism to metal and plastic engravings.




Engraver is an Blender addon with set of few tools designed to help carving decals in 3d models. This addon was designed to support modeling with custom normals workflow.
Engraver_v**.py – Addon for Blender 2.7*
Engraver_(2_8)_v**.py – Addon for Blender 2.8
How to use it:
Simply select your decal geometry, then select your surface geometry on which you want to place it, use ALT+Q shortcut and chose from available tools:
Tools description:
Engrave – Merges predefined geometry of your decal onto selected surface geometry.
Engrave flat (Experimental) – This tool is still under development. It allows to define simple convex or concave decal from flat geometry. Works similar way as Engrave tool but instead of predefined decal geometry you can use flat geometry. After running the tool you can modify it’s bevel by moving mouse and accept it by clicking LMB. After applying bevel width you’re able to define depth of decal the same way as with bevel: mouse movement+LMP for apply.
Cut – Cut a crevice according to border edges of your flat decal geomtery.
Booleans – Simple boolean tools which maintains custom normal information of your meshes.
Mirror – Mirror model with custom normals.
Supercharge your 3D creation workflow with premium selection of Blender Add-ons. Whether you are modeling intricate characters, sculpting realistic environments, or animating cinematic sequences, the right add-on can transform how you work inside Blender. Our curated collection includes powerful tools for UV unwrapping, procedural texture generation, rigging automation, rendering optimization, and more—each rigorously tested for compatibility with the latest Blender versions. Eliminate tedious manual processes and unlock advanced functionality that lets you focus on what matters most: bringing your creative vision to life. Explore our full range of professional Blender plugins today and take your 3D projects to the next level.
➡️ ➡️ For more Blender Plugins 😀 😀

Reviews
There are no reviews yet.